P1B52 – BMW DTC

BMW DTC P1B52 – Drive Motor ‘A’ Phase U Current Sensor Circuit Current Out of Range Low

DTC P1B52 meaning on BMW

The DTC P1B52 error code on a BMW indicates an issue with the Drive Motor ‘A’ Phase U Current Sensor Circuit, specifically that the current is out of range low. This fault typically points to a problem with the electrical circuit or sensor related to the current measurement in the drive motor system.

BMW DTC P1B52 symptoms

Symptoms of the BMW DTC P1B52 code may include abnormal or reduced performance of the drive motor, decreased power output, unusual noises coming from the motor, and in some cases, the vehicle may go into a reduced power mode or fail to operate altogether.

BMW DTC P1B52 causes

The causes of the DTC P1B52 error code on a BMW can vary, but common reasons include a malfunctioning current sensor, damaged wiring or connectors in the current sensor circuit, issues with the drive motor itself, or a fault in the control module that manages the drive motor system.

BMW DTC P1B52 seriousness

The seriousness of the BMW DTC P1B52 code lies in the potential impact on the drive motor’s performance and overall vehicle operation. Ignoring this fault can lead to further damage to the drive motor system and may result in unsafe driving conditions or even complete drive motor failure.

How to diagnose DTC P1B52 on BMW

To diagnose the DTC P1B52 code on a BMW, a thorough inspection of the drive motor system, current sensor circuit, and related components is necessary. This may involve using a diagnostic scanner to retrieve specific fault codes, checking the wiring and connectors for any visible damage, and testing the current sensor for proper functionality.

How to fix DTC P1B52 on BMW

Fixing the DTC P1B52 code on a BMW typically involves repairing or replacing the faulty components identified during the diagnostic process. This may include replacing the current sensor, repairing damaged wiring or connectors, addressing issues with the drive motor, or reprogramming the control module if necessary.

How to erase DTC P1B52 on BMW

Once the underlying issue causing the DTC P1B52 code on a BMW has been resolved, the code can be cleared using a diagnostic scanner. By accessing the vehicle’s onboard computer system, you can erase the fault code and reset the system, allowing for a fresh start and monitoring for any recurring issues.
